Output efdd2d014f134730258deecb558b0243e27862267d7fcfc19ea2607b60e5be6e:0

value
1820176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1278f5e09e757e4b4b7e02462675bffba1c7b33f OP_EQUAL
address
33NgzUbuT1aPAZhDJurwC9QaTJrPT4jNHk
transaction
efdd2d014f134730258deecb558b0243e27862267d7fcfc19ea2607b60e5be6e
confirmations
1918
spent
true